Use of Cardiopulmonary Bypass in High-Risk Patients Is a Predictor of Adverse Outcome

Abstract

High-risk patients experience substantially more compli cations after coronary artery bypass grafting (CABG). We hypothesized that these patients are uniquely vulner able to cardiopulmonary bypass and compared postop erative outcomes between high-risk patients undergo ing off-pump CAB (OPCAB) and conventional CABG. Prospective provincial cardiac care registry and retro spective chart data were reviewed for 1,850 consecutive patients at our …
